> > > > The L1 substates support requires additional steps to work, namely:
> > > > -Proper handling of the CLKREQ# sideband signal. (It is mostly handled by
> > > >  hardware, but software still needs to set the clkreq fields in the
> > > >  PCIE_CLIENT_POWER_CON register to match the hardware implementation.)
> > > > -Program the frequency of the aux clock into the
> > > >  DSP_PCIE_PL_AUX_CLK_FREQ_OFF register. (During L1 substates the core_clk
> > > >  is turned off and the aux_clk is used instead.)
